Build Powerful Surveys with Qualtrics

Seelye Hall 212 Seelye Hall, Northampton, MA, United States

Qualtrics is a sophisticated yet simple online survey platform for creating and distributing surveys as well as generating detailed reports. Flexible question types allow researchers to collect quantitative and qualitative data. Features like embedded data, branching, display logic, quotas, email triggers, mobile and offline compatibility, and randomization ensure that your survey can do whatever you … Continued
